Output 1044294a21c08a1a46fdb9ef8765e02c375bddfe8ef84e1a3933c26542b44f26:7

value
146481
script pubkey
OP_0 OP_PUSHBYTES_20 687e81a9c9f36fcca261dc790c32529d871bb446
address
bc1qdplgr2wf7dhuegnpm3uscvjjnkr3hdzx92gx8r
transaction
1044294a21c08a1a46fdb9ef8765e02c375bddfe8ef84e1a3933c26542b44f26
confirmations
219086
spent
true